ok i'm totally addicted to nora roberts. and was thinking aloud why. i mean i id the romance thing in high school and bascially kicked it. then in college i was at a friend's house and she had. oh i can't remember the book. but it is the saga with the sisters and the brothers and the nosey grandfather. in one the girls live together in the house. another book...oh yes i think one of girls name was serena and she was working on cruise boat. anyway i got hooked. i finally read the in death books. i haven't read everything by her...yet. eve is one kick butt gal and roarke...yum. most of her stuff i read twice. sometimes 2 and 4 times.
but i finally figured out why i love her stuff. her books aren't really about romance. they are about relationships...all kinds. how each person is woven together like a tapstry. these events murder, mystery, mayhem, love, or whatver that places people in each other's paths are all part of the tapstry she weaves each book. most writers i notice focus on the main characters and the others are like sidekicks. but not for her. the others help lay foundations. guide our characters. and if they die or are hurt or happy we are with them just as we are with her main people. i didn't realise it until i was reading visons in death. i completely skipped it. and i was looking for. cause in that book it explains some events that happen to another character. it actually made me mad before i read it, cause i thiugh that story didn't exisit and i didn't understand why not, when she is usually very good about this connections. and when i found it i realized yes this is why i love reading ms roberts books.
also even without the mayhem thats brings the characters together, each character is alive on their own. she also creats her own timelines as sh has done in her in death series. sometimes i feel as if i'm entering into a different worls with her. actually when she makes reference to something like forest hills (site of the us open before it moved to flushing) i remember oh yes i am reading a story aren't i.
